Recent progress in chemoradiotherapy for oesophageal squamous cell carcinoma
Kotoe Oshima1, Takahiro Tsushima1, Yoshinori Ito2
1Division of Gastrointestinal Oncology, Shizuoka Cancer Center, 1007 Shimonagakubo, Nagaizumi-cho, Sunto-gun, Shizuoka, 411-8777, Japan.
Chemoradiotherapy is standard for oesophageal squamous cell carcinoma but has drawbacks. Combining it with immunotherapy shows promise for improved outcomes and manageable side effects in clinical trials.

Background:
- Oesophageal squamous cell carcinoma (ESCC) is a prevalent global cancer.
- Chemoradiotherapy is the standard treatment for resectable and locally advanced unresectable ESCC.
- Current chemoradiotherapy approaches face challenges including poor survival rates and treatment toxicities.
Approach:
- This review synthesizes existing clinical data on chemoradiotherapy for ESCC.
- It examines the development of combining chemoradiotherapy with immunotherapy.
- The synergistic mechanisms and early clinical trial findings are discussed.
Key Points:
- Chemoradiotherapy offers a standard treatment but is associated with significant toxicities and limited survival.
- Multimodal strategies, including salvage surgery, are vital for advanced ESCC.
- Palliative chemoradiotherapy plays a role in managing dysphagia.
Conclusions:
- Emerging evidence suggests that combining chemoradiotherapy with immunotherapy may enhance clinical outcomes in ESCC.
- Early phase trials indicate manageable side effects with this combined approach.
- Further investigation is warranted to validate the efficacy and safety of chemoradiotherapy plus immunotherapy for ESCC.
